> Robert van der Veeke wrote: > > Question: Both Screenviewer (1.27) and Diskimage manager > > (1.12) give a diskerror under WinXP, has a solution for this? > > NT/W2K/XP require a different method of reading from real floppy disks, > which aren't yet supported. > > However, the following command-line utility will let you copy to and from > real SAM disks under XP: http://www.simcoupe.org/SamDiskNT.zip Run it > without any parameters for basic instructions. It should also work fine on > Windows 2000, but needs a different version of the driver to work on NT4 > (I'll build one if needed). > > I'll need to check if Dave Laundon has a newer version of the main program, > to sort out an official release...
